Here is information about our Tiny Tiger Program. The high school class is known as Careers with Children. This is a sequence of classes for the high school students to learn about teaching and working with young children. The high school students must take and pass the prerequisite class, Developmental Psychology of Children, before taking Careers with Children. There is also a screening process with that teacher, with their councilor, and other administrative staff to make sure they are a good candidate for working in Tiny Tigers. We spend the first several weeks learning about lesson planning, developmental stages, safety, emergency procedures, and what they are expected to do as “teachers”. They are the teachers in the Tiny Tiger Program.
